Ingredients

  • 1/2 tablespoon essential olive oil
  • 1/2 moderate onion chopped
  • 2 sticks celery ch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ic clove minced
  • 1 pound extra slim (95% slim) floor beef
  • 2 heaping t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 (28 liquid ounce) can diced tomato vegetables with juices
  • 4 cups meat broth
  • 2 large Russet potatoes diced
  • 1 dash Italian seasoning
  • Sodium & p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Add the essential olive oil, onion, and celery to a big soup container. Sauté for 5-7 moments, until softened.
  2. Stir within the garlic, accompanied by the beef. Make until the meat offers browned, stirring sometimes (about five minutes). You mustn’t need to deplete much fat if you are using extra slim ground meat, but feel absolve to drain some/many from it if preferred (I didn’t deplete any).
  3. Stir within the tomato paste, adding within the diced tomatoes, meat broth, potatoes, and Italian seasoning.
  4. Increase the warmth and provide the soup to some boil. Decrease the heat a little so it’s softly boiling. Make for 20-25 moments. You can prepare it a bit more time to intensify the taste if you want.
  5. Season with sodium & pepper as required and serve instantly.

Recipe Notes
Serves 4-6.
Anything from about 1 to at least one 1.5 lbs ground beef will continue to work.
Use low-sodium meat broth if you are sensitive to sodium.
